    Hello
    I would like the positioning the search box on the left side above the shopping cart box.
    I managed this selector:

    .header2 .search {
    display: table-cell;
    vertical-align:top;
    float:right;
    text-align: right;
    }

    but the .header2 .shopping-cart-widget is still too height to let the search box allign above it

    Hello,

    You can remove it in Appearance > Widgets > Main sideba widget area. If this block is empty and search box is displayed anyway, then you need drag an empty Text widget into there and save it.

    Hello,

    There is a bug in the theme. You have to rename “portfolio” slug to something else, for example “our-portfolio”. So you need edit Portfolio page and change its Permalink: http://mosquecarpetusa.com/portfolio/ to http://mosquecarpetusa.com/our-portfolio/ (or name it something else). After that changes you’ve saved will take effect.
